Accelerometers and Gyroscopes

Q-Flex QA-3000 Single Axis Quartz Accelerometer

Q-Flex QA-3000 Single Axis Quartz Accelerometer

Overview
Honeywell’s Q-Flex QA-3000 single axis quartz accelerometer provides customers with the highest inertial navigation-grade performance available on today’s market.

Engineered to use the same form factor as the QA-2000, the QA-3000 packs a lot of performance and value, proving the same inherent quality and reliability customers have come to know from Honeywell Q-flex accelerometers.

As with the entire Q-Flex family of accelerometers, the QA-650 features a patented Q-Flex etched-quartz-flexure seismic system and its amorphous quartz proof-mass structure provides excellent bias, scale factor and axis alignment stability.

The QA-3000 has three performance grades to best meet customer’s performance requirements.

Specifications

Performance

  • Bias
    • <4 mg
  • Scale Factor - Temperature Sensitivity
    • <120 ppm/°C
  • Bias -One-year Composite Repeatability
    • <125 µg (QA3000-010)
    • <40 µg (QA3000-030)
    • <80µg (QA3000-020)
  • Bias - Temperature Sensitivity
    • <15 μg/°C
    • <25 μg/°C (QA3000-010)
  • Vibration Rectification
    • QA3000-010: <20 μg/g²rms (50-500 Hz) <50 μg/g²rms (500-2000 H
    • QA3000-020: <15 μg/g2rms (50-500 Hz) <40 μg/g²rms (500-2000 Hz)
    • QA3000-030: <10 μg/g2rms (50-500 Hz) <35 μg/g2rms (500-2000 Hz)
  • Resolution/Threshold
    • <1 µg
  • Vibration Peak Sine
    • 15 g @ 20-2000 Hz
  • Intrinsic Noise
    • <1500 μg-rms (500-10,000 Hz)
    • <7 μg-rms (0-10 Hz)
    • <70 μg-rms (10-500 Hz)
  • Scale Factor
    • 1.20 to 1.46 mA/g
  • Key Benefits
    • Temperature-compensating algorithms dramatically improve bias, scale factor, and axis misalignment performance
  • Models
    • QA3000-010
    • QA3000-020
    • QA3000-030
  • Shock
    • 100 g (QA3000-030)
    • 150 g

Mechanical

  • Axis Misalignment - One-year Composite Repeatability
    • <100 µrad (QA3000-010)
    • <70 µrad (QA3000-030)
    • <80 µrad (QA3000-020)
  • Operating Temperature
    • -28°C to +78°C (QA3000-030)
    • -55°C to +95°C (QA3000-010)
    • -55°C to +95°C (QA3000-020)
  • Axis Misalignment
    • <1000 µrad
    • <1500 µrad (QA3000-010)

Connectivity and Systems

  • Scale Factor - One-year Composite Repeatability
    • <160 ppm (QA3000-020)
    • <250 ppm (QA3000-010)
    • <80 ppm (QA3000-030)
  • Electrical Interface
    • +10 VDC Output
    • -10 VDC Output
    • Current Self Test
    • Power / Signal Ground
    • Temp Sensor
    • Voltage Self Test
  • Bandwidth
    • >300 Hz
  • Output
    • Analog

Power and Electrical

  • Quiescent Current per Supply
    • <16 mA
  • Quiescent Power
    • <480 mW @ ±15 VDC
  • Input Voltage
    • ±13 to ±28 VDC
  • Input Range
    • ±60 g

Environmental

  • Thermal Modeling
    • Yes

Certification

  • Certifications
    • ISO-9001

Physical

  • Case Material
    • 300 Series Stainless Steel
  • Dimensions
    • 0.585 in. Max Height (bottom to mounting surface)
    • 585 in. Max Height (bottom to mounting surface)
    • Ø1.005 in. Max Diameter (below mounting surface)
  • Weight
    • 71 ±4 grams
